Word Of The Day: Fläskpannkaka

First of all, we love the sound of this word. This is Swedish for a very special kind of pancake, or pannkaka. In fact, we think all pancakes should be called pannkaka from now on. This particular pannkaka, the fläskpannkaka, is your dream pancake, i.e. a bacon pancake.

The Swedes cook pieces of bacon, or smoked pork, pour pancake batter over it and then cook the whole mess in a tray in the oven. This makes for a very large pancake, which can be cut up and shared, or you could try to eat the entire thing yourself. Traditionally, the fläskpannkaka is slathered with lingonberry jam and served for dinner on Thursdays.
